Homework:小写字母转大写字母

 1 // 功能:
 2   // 从键盘上输入单个字符
 3   // 如果是小写字母,则转换成大写后输出
 4   // 否则,什么也不做,原样输出
 5   
 6   #include <stdio.h>
 7   int main() {
 8       char ch;
 9       
10       printf("输入一个字符:\n");
11       scanf("%c",&ch);
12       
13       // 根据程序功能描述,补足程序
14       if(ch>='a'&&ch<='z'  );  // 如果ch是小写字母,补足判定ch是小写字母的表达式
15       ch = ch-'a' +'A';       // 补足把ch中的小字母转换成大写字母的表达式语句
16                // 说明:语句就是在表达式末尾加分号;
17       
18       printf("%c\n",ch);
19       
20       return 0;
21   }

 体会和感悟:我觉得c语言让我们学会了使用电脑来代替人脑来思考和解决问题,是一种让我们增强逻辑性的程序。

猜你喜欢

转载自www.cnblogs.com/tty-1999/p/10566942.html